The 60s was a revolution. The new generation wanted change. They wanted love, peace, no war, everyone to be equal, and much more. They would parade up and down streets with their message. They would spend countless hours spreading their message of change. They weren't about to back down from anyone or anything. They wanted their message to be heard. They were trying to make their world a better place. John Lennon and Yoko Ono had a "Bed-In," in 1969. It was their way of promoting peace and apposing the Vietnam War with non-violence. The 60s was a time of change with help from everyone.
